Hi,
I just got bnu24bn.zip djeoe112.zip gpp260.zip mak371bn.zip djdev112.zip
gas23bn.zip gzp124bn.zip txi310bn.zip djdoc112.zip gcc260bn.zip lgp260bn.zip
and installed correctly (hopefully) everything. Then:
        cd djgpp/samples/hello
        tryit.bat
compiled and run just fine!

But, any other sample that comes with a makefile does not compile if I
'make'.  Seems like something is going on with make itself, because if:
        cd djgpp/samples/pagetest
        gcc -O2 pagetest.c -o pagetest
it compiles just fine.
but if I:
        cd djgpp/samples/pagetest
        make
it prints the 'gcc -O2 pagetest.c -o pagetest' on the screen, and then
`deadlocks' (numlock doesn't change the light indicator.) Mem reports
around 13Mb of free extended memory.

If anyone has gone through this before, or it sounds familiar, and you
know what I am doing wrong, please alert me.
